Cooking Tips
Use Firm Bananas:
Choose bananas that are firm and slightly underripe for this recipe. Overripe bananas may become too mushy during frying and lose their shape.
Watch the Oil Temperature:
Maintain the oil temperature around medium heat to ensure the fritters cook evenly. If the oil is too hot, the outside will brown too quickly while the inside remains uncooked.
Customize the Filling:
Feel free to experiment with different fillings. Try stuffing the fritters with fruits like apples or pears, or add a bit of chocolate or peanut butter for a twist on flavor.
Double-Coating:
For an extra crispy texture, you can double-coat the fritters in the cinnamon-sugar mixture: once while they are warm and again after they’ve cooled slightly.
